The Toll House, Branch Bridge, Queen Adelaide, Ely, Cambridgeshire

Detached House

Guide Price £450,000

  • 3
  • 1
  • 1
  • 1
  • 19

A stunning character home, formerly The Toll House, now a beautiful three bedroom detached home with fantastic views over the river towards Ely Cathedral and only 2 &1/2miles to Littleport train station and 4 miles from Ely. There is also planning permission for an office/garage and mooring rights.

QUEEN ADELAIDE

is a small hamlet, which is situated about half a mile from the Cathedral City of Ely. The Toll House is situated in a riverside location which lies approximately 4 miles from Ely where there is an excellent range of shopping facilities, schools, various sporting and social activities including Ely Leisure Village incorporating a sports centre, swimming pool, multi-screen cinema and restaurants. Ely also has a mainline railway station connecting to Cambridge and London.

ENTRANCE HALL

with staircase rising to first floor and under stairs storage cupboard. Radiator.

BEDROOM ONE

3.49 x 4.83

with feature original ornamental Victorian fireplace, windows to front and side aspects, radiator.

BEDROOM TWO

3.49 x 3.54

with window to front aspect, fitted wardrobes, radiator

BEDROOM THREE

2.92 x 3.61

with window to side aspect, radiator.

FAMILY BATHROOM

Fitted with a contemporary suite comprising pebble shape bath with central tap, walk-in shower cubicle, wash hand basin with cupboard under, Victorian tiled floor, heated towel rail, spotlights, extractor fan and low level WC.

FIRST FLOOR OPEN PLAN KITCHEN/FAMILY ROOM

6.58 x 8.44

KITCHEN AREA fitted with white gloss and blue matt contemporary wall units, base units and drawers with complimentary worksurfaces over, inset 1 & 1/4 single drainer sink unit with mixer taps, fitted oven, microwave, hob and extractor fan, integrated fridge/freezer, cupboard housing recycle bins, central island unit with breakfast bar, wine rack, integral dishwasher, wood effect Karndean flooring, spotlights, radiators, access to loft with ladder.FAMILY AREA having feature fireplace with log burner, spotlights, two sets of French doors leading onto a glass bordered balcony giving superb views of the river and surrounding countryside.

UTILITY/CLOAKROOM

with low level WC, wash hand basin, space for washing machine/tumbler drier.

EXTERIOR

The property has a lawned garden area with summer house. There is parking for approximately 3/4 vehicles, with the River Great Ouse being situated adjacent to the property there are superb opportunities for fishing, walking, bird watching etc.The property has planning permission for an office / garage and mooring rights.

AGENTS NOTES

The house has Calor Gas heating, aluminium windows, Argon double glazing and alarm system fitted.
